Abstract :
In this paper, we propose a low-complexity soft-output channel detector for turbo equalization over coded partial-response channels based on the simulated annealing (SA) algorithm. It is shown that the proposed detector can significantly reduce the computational complexity with only slight performance degradation compared to the BCJR algorithm
